A curved linear transducer containing multiple piezoelectric elements is called

Explanation:
A curved linear transducer with multiple piezoelectric elements is called a convex array. The curved arrangement of many elements forms an arc, producing a sector-shaped (convex) footprint on the patient and allowing electronic focusing and steering to cover a wider field of view. Aperture refers to the width of the active element group, and apodization is a technique that adjusts excitation across elements to reduce sidelobes; neither term describes the curved, arc-shaped layout. An array is a general term for multiple elements, but the specific curved layout is what defines a convex array.
